Daniel McDonnell: Winning is the only option if Shelbourne are to gain value from extended season in Europe
"The organisation of a training camp in Spain to prepare for the second half of their Conference League campaign reflects Shelbourne's desire to make the most of their maiden mission at this level. Joey O'Brien has repeatedly made the point that his players are much happier being at work until December rather than going on holidays like the vast majority of their peers around the league."
"An attractive trip to face AZ Alkmaar and the visit of Crystal Palace to these shores requires concert-pitch preparation to compensate for the end of the domestic season."
